Islabikes is a British manufacturer of bicycles. The company was established in 2005 by the former cyclist Isla Rowntree and has specialized in the manufacture of children's bikes. Islabikes is known to produce very light bikes where all components are designed for children.[1][2][3][4][5][6] The head office is situated in Bromfield, Shropshire in the United Kingdom.
